Output 1cb86c2622060e22ac4c5fdf7f583e9678f18a30fe4d44120fff3474840155e4:4

value
3122881503
script pubkey
OP_0 OP_PUSHBYTES_20 e695f18a77570f2917f37305e0a8f808cac3b1ed
address
bc1qu62lrznh2u8jj9lnwvz7p28cpr9v8v0de5rx6n
transaction
1cb86c2622060e22ac4c5fdf7f583e9678f18a30fe4d44120fff3474840155e4